Most Popular Books
Series By Rebecca L. Oxford
Language Learning Strategies: What Every Teacher Should Know
$17.39
The Tapestry of Language Learning: The Individual in the Communicative Classroom (Methodology)
$8.09 - $8.49
Simulation Gaming and Language Learning
$8.69 - $9.69
Patterns of Cultural Identity: Advanced Culture-Tapestry
Out of Stock
Teaching & Researching: Language Learning Strategies
$54.93 - $180.00
Language of Peace (Peace Education)
$60.69 - $99.74
Teaching and Researching Language Learning Strategies: Self-Regulation in Context, Second Edition
$70.22 - $200.00
Tapestry Reading L2 (Middle East Edition)
Out of Stock